SKIP THE DISANAS. Useless, fiddly, annoying. They don't even dry that fast.

Might want some PUL covers, wool is nice but I find it impractical for daytime use. 6 covers for the newborn stage is about right, bummis, thirsties, motherease rikkis, imse vimse, nikkys all work well over prefolds/flats.

Actually, I love the Disanas. But, they don't stand alone - you need something to stuff inside them.

And I never put a cover over them - shorties/longies are the only covers that work, but it takes a lot for the outside to feel wet - by which time it needs changing, so that's what we do.

I may also suggest finding some fitteds for newborns. Like a kissaluvs. I find that the one sizes didn't fit my baby (and he was a big boy) very well right at first, so we needed something smaller. Plus it has the snap down for umbilical cord. Depending on your baby's size, you can wear them for several months. DS1 wore them for 5-6 months and only had to come out of them b/c of rise issues. DS2 is already out of them at 3 months. They need a PUL cover.
